Reference Handling
Local Reference
Remote Reference
The reference handling system for calculating the remote reference is shown in the illustration
below.
The remote reference is calculated once every scan interval and initially consists of
two parts:
1.
2.
The two parts are combined in the following calculation: Remote reference = X + X * Y / 100%.

The scaling of analog references is described in par. groups 6-1* and 6-2*, and the scaling of
digital pulse references is described in par. group 5-5*.
Reference limits and ranges are set in par. group 3-0*.
X (the external reference): A sum (see par. 3-04) of up to four externally selected ref-
erences, comprising any combination (determined by the setting of par. 3-15, 3-16 and
3-17) of a fixed preset reference (par. 3-10), variable analog references, variable digital
pulse references, and various serial bus references in whatever unit the adjustable fre-
quency drive is controlled ([Hz], [RPM], [Nm], etc.).
Y- (the relative reference): A sum of one fixed preset reference (par. 3-14) and one
variable analog reference (par. 3-18) in [%].
